Transaction 570dbeba06c2648a47af0408ea26cf82dc34dbc1e77fc8df874c24257047d562

1 Input
2 Outputs
  • 570dbeba06c2648a47af0408ea26cf82dc34dbc1e77fc8df874c24257047d562:0
  • value  621861628
    address  39w4Q7iN76NszrBD3yjUxTyxqrkebEHpL5
  • 570dbeba06c2648a47af0408ea26cf82dc34dbc1e77fc8df874c24257047d562:1
  • value  26630016
    address  3D5HRmu5wpuvEf5ww1RrgHbyyCXyrfNyui